Natural Monopoly
A market condition in which a single firm can supply a good or service to an entire market at a lower cost than could two or more firms.
Patent Laws
Legal statutes that grant inventors exclusive rights to their inventions, preventing others from making, using, or selling the invention for a certain period of time.
